Letter: Is This a Prudent Policy?

After reading the main article in the Belmont Voice, ‘Board Sets $8.4M Override’ (Feb. 20) as well as a letter titled ‘Pass the Override,’ I sensed the urgency that’s reflected in them about the overall situation the Town of Belmont is facing — possible school closings, drastic cuts to police and fire, delaying badly needed repairs, and more.

I think many of us taxpayers who question the Override wonder why all these things were not taken into consideration when we were asked to approve the new ice skating rink as well as the demolishing and rebuilding of the library. Were these items not in the Select Board’s purview prior to the present issues that now require an override?

We would think that a prudent policy would’ve demanded us to secure the aforementioned ills of the budget excesses prior to deciding to spend millions on ice skating and the library.

Andreas Geovanos, Chester Road
